CareerPath
Conservation Storyteller : Craft compelling narratives that highlight conservation efforts, engaging diverse audiences and driving awareness for environmental initiatives.
Behavior Change Specialist : Design and implement strategies that influence public behavior towards sustainable practices, utilizing storytelling as a tool for effectiveness.
Environmental Educator : Develop educational content that integrates storytelling to teach conservation principles, aiming to inspire future generations about environmental stewardship.
Communications Manager : Oversee communication strategies for conservation organizations, ensuring that storytelling aligns with organizational goals and resonates with target audiences.
Content Creator : Generate multimedia content that utilizes storytelling techniques to promote conservation messages across various platforms and engage a wider audience.
Social Media Strategist : Leverage social media platforms to share impactful conservation stories, driving engagement and mobilizing communities towards environmental action.
Research Analyst : Analyze trends and data in conservation storytelling, providing insights that inform strategies for behavioral change and effective communication.
